Quarterly Planning Note — Insurance Renewal

Branch managers: our combined property and liability policy with Merrowgate Assurance renews at the end of the quarter. Premiums are expected to rise roughly 9% given last year's claims at the Caldwell depot. Please submit updated asset registers and incident logs by the fifteenth so the renewal reflects current exposure. Branches with clean records may see offsetting discounts.

One confidential planning item follows directly below.

management briefing: Eliaxax Works is in early talks to buy Casoxox Systems for about $61.5 million. The Framir launch date is May 17, and nothing goes to the press before then.

- [ ] **Step 7: Breaker override escrow.** After sealing the signing keys for the Tallgrove upstream API circuit breaker, confirm the support team can force the breaker open during a full outage. The override bundle lives in the sealed escrow drawer and is useless without its unlock phrase. Two ceremony witnesses must initial this step before proceeding. The escrow bundle is decrypted with the recovery passphrase that follows.

vault phrase of kahip-kahop = holath-quenmir

Per-tenant quotas on the Marletto gateway are enforced at 500 requests/min, burst 100. Exceeding the quota returns 429 with a Retry-After header; the limiter resets on a sliding window. On-call can inspect or temporarily raise a tenant's quota via the internal quota-admin endpoint, which requires the operations service key on each request. That key follows below.

API key for yahig-tadup: kto7_ubizbYm